“Tim Daly (Wings) and Veronica Ferres (Hector and the Search for Happiness) have been tapped for roles in Unholy Trinity, rounding out the ensemble for the Western helmed by Robert the Bruce‘s Richard Gray. The actors join an ensemble that also includes Pierce Brosnan, Samuel L. Jackson, Brandon Lessard, and Q’orianka Kilcher, as previously announced.
Currently shooting under an Interim Agreement, the film written by Lee Zachariah is set against the turbulent backdrop of 1870s Montana. It picks up in the moments before the execution of Isaac Broadway, as he gives his estranged son, Henry (Lessard), an impossible task: murder the man who framed him for a crime he didn’t commit. Intent on fulfilling his promise, Henry travels to the remote town of Trinity, where an unexpected turn of events traps him in town and leaves him caught between Gabriel Dove (Brosnan), the town’s upstanding new sheriff, and a mysterious figure named St. Christopher (Jackson).
Daly portrays Henry, the father of Lessard’s Isaac, with Ferres as Sarah, the midwife married to Sheriff Gabriel. Producers on the project include Carter Boehm, Richard Gray, Colin Floom, Michele Gray, Kellie Brooks and Jeanne Allgood. Amadeus Productions is exec producing.”

A wannabe rock star who fronts a Pennsylvania-based tribute band is devastated when his kick him out of the group he founded. Things begin to look up for Izzy when he is asked to join Steel Dragon, the heavy metal rockers he had been imitating for so long. This film is loosely based on the true story of the band Judas Priest.

Preston Peltier Grabs Pole for Snowball Derby (Photos)
It is one of the most pressure-filled events in all of short track racing – qualifying day for the Snowball Derby. The 50th version of the historic running did not disappoint with plenty of dramatics during time trials on Friday night at Five Flags Speedway in Pensacola, Florida.
Preston Peltier turned a lap of 16.319 seconds which edged Bubba Pollard for the top spot during time trials. Defending Derby winner Christian Eckes was the last to qualify and tied the time of Stephen Nasse and Donnie Wilson at 16.660 seconds. That forged a three-way tie for the 30th and final guaranteed spot in the field. By virtue of setting the time first, Nasse secured his spot.
Drivers who did not qualifying into Sunday’s race will have an opportunity to race into the show during Saturday’s last-chance race. Several provisionals are also up for grabs. For more information follow Five Flags Speedway on Facebook

Metalsucks Podcast – The Contortionist Vocalist Michael Lessard on The MetalSucks Podcast #205
This week we talk to The Contortionist vocalist Michael Lessard. We discuss the band’s new record Clairvoyant and the pressure of following up their critically acclaimed previous album Language, the role producer Jamie King plays in helping to craft the band’s music, negativity from the band’s fans on Facebook, his passions for video work and MMA, and much more.
